Why engagement operations become the bottleneck in professional services
In professional services, the commercial promise is sold before the delivery machine is fully engaged. That creates a structural risk: sales commits timelines, delivery teams manage capacity, finance protects margins and operations tries to reconcile all three. If these functions are disconnected, the business experiences avoidable delays and hidden cost. A project may be sold without validated skills availability. A statement of work may be approved without billing rules reflected in the ERP. Timesheets may be submitted on time but not linked to milestone billing. Leadership then sees lagging indicators instead of operational intelligence.
ERP process automation matters because engagement operations are cross-functional by nature. The workflow begins before project kickoff and continues through staffing, execution, change control, invoicing, collections and renewal. A business-first automation strategy therefore focuses on handoffs, approvals, exceptions and decision points. The goal is to eliminate manual process dependency where it creates delay or inconsistency, while keeping human review where commercial judgment, compliance or customer sensitivity requires it.
What should be automated first in a services ERP operating model
The highest-value automation opportunities are usually found in the transition points between revenue stages. In practice, firms gain the fastest business impact when they automate the path from qualified opportunity to approved engagement, from approved engagement to staffed project and from delivered work to recognized revenue. Odoo capabilities become relevant when they directly support these transitions. CRM can trigger engagement readiness workflows. Project and Planning can align staffing and delivery schedules. Accounting can enforce billing logic and revenue controls. Approvals and Documents can standardize governance around contracts, scope changes and exceptions.
- Opportunity-to-engagement automation: validate commercial terms, required skills, target margin and delivery prerequisites before kickoff.
- Resource-to-project automation: match consultant availability, role requirements, utilization targets and regional constraints before assignment.
- Work-to-cash automation: connect timesheets, milestones, expenses, approvals and invoicing rules to reduce revenue leakage.
- Change-to-governance automation: route scope changes, budget overruns and delivery risks through structured approval paths.
- Issue-to-resolution automation: escalate customer risks, SLA breaches or staffing conflicts based on business impact and contractual commitments.
How workflow orchestration improves delivery predictability
Workflow orchestration is the discipline of coordinating multiple systems, teams and decisions around a business outcome. In engagement operations, that outcome is not a single task completion. It is a controlled service lifecycle. This is where many firms underinvest. They automate isolated tasks such as reminder emails or invoice generation, but they do not orchestrate the full engagement journey. As a result, local efficiency improves while enterprise predictability does not.
A stronger model uses event-driven automation. When a deal reaches a committed stage, the ERP can trigger a readiness workflow. When a project budget threshold is crossed, finance and delivery leaders can be alerted automatically. When a milestone is approved, billing can be prepared without waiting for manual reconciliation. REST APIs and Webhooks are relevant here because they allow CRM, HR, project systems, collaboration tools and customer support platforms to exchange events in near real time. Middleware or API Gateways may be justified when the enterprise needs centralized policy enforcement, transformation logic or integration governance across multiple business units.
| Operational challenge | Manual approach | Automated ERP-centered approach | Business outcome |
|---|---|---|---|
| Project kickoff delays | Email-based handoffs between sales and delivery | Opportunity stage triggers engagement checklist, approvals and project template creation | Faster mobilization and fewer missed prerequisites |
| Resource conflicts | Spreadsheet staffing reviews | Planning rules align skills, availability and utilization thresholds | Better staffing quality and reduced bench or overload |
| Revenue leakage | Manual invoice preparation from timesheets and milestones | Accounting workflows connect approved work records to billing rules | Improved billing timeliness and margin protection |
| Scope creep | Informal change requests | Approvals and Documents enforce structured change control | Stronger governance and commercial discipline |
Architecture choices: embedded ERP automation versus integration-led orchestration
Executives often ask whether engagement automation should live primarily inside the ERP or in an external orchestration layer. The answer depends on process complexity, system diversity and governance requirements. Embedded ERP automation is usually the right starting point when the process is centered on ERP records and decisions. Odoo Automation Rules, Scheduled Actions and Server Actions can support practical business workflows when the logic is close to projects, approvals, accounting or planning data. This reduces architectural sprawl and keeps ownership close to operations.
An integration-led model becomes more appropriate when engagement operations span multiple enterprise platforms, regional entities or partner ecosystems. For example, if staffing data sits in HR systems, customer commitments in CRM, delivery telemetry in project tools and billing controls in ERP, orchestration may need to sit above the applications. In those cases, APIs, Webhooks and middleware can coordinate events and policies across systems. The trade-off is clear: embedded automation is simpler and often faster to govern, while external orchestration offers broader reach and flexibility but requires stronger observability, change management and integration ownership.
A practical decision framework
| Decision factor | Favor ERP-native automation | Favor external orchestration |
|---|---|---|
| Primary system of record | ERP owns the process and data | Process spans several systems equally |
| Change frequency | Stable workflows with clear ownership | Frequent cross-system process changes |
| Governance model | Business-led operational control | Central integration or enterprise architecture control |
| Exception handling | Mostly transactional exceptions | Complex multi-step exception routing |
| Scalability needs | Departmental or business-unit scale | Enterprise-wide orchestration across regions or partners |
Where AI-assisted Automation and Agentic AI fit, and where they do not
AI-assisted Automation can improve engagement operations when it supports decision quality, not when it replaces accountability. Useful examples include summarizing project risk signals, drafting scope change recommendations, classifying support issues, identifying billing anomalies or helping project managers prepare status narratives from structured ERP data. AI Copilots can also help consultants and operations teams retrieve policy, contract or delivery knowledge faster when connected to governed enterprise content.
Agentic AI should be introduced carefully. In professional services, autonomous action is only appropriate where the business can tolerate bounded decisions, clear approval thresholds and full auditability. For example, an AI agent may recommend staffing alternatives or prepare draft follow-up actions after a project health review, but final assignment and commercial approval should remain governed. If firms explore AI Agents, RAG or model routing through platforms such as OpenAI, Azure OpenAI, Qwen, LiteLLM, vLLM or Ollama, the architecture should be driven by data governance, model control, privacy requirements and operational supportability rather than novelty. The business question is simple: does AI reduce cycle time or improve decision consistency without increasing risk?
Governance, compliance and risk controls executives should insist on
Automation in engagement operations touches contracts, customer data, employee schedules, financial controls and delivery commitments. That means governance cannot be added later. Identity and Access Management should define who can trigger, approve, override or audit automated decisions. Approval paths should be role-based and aligned to commercial authority. Logging, Monitoring, Alerting and Observability are directly relevant because leaders need to know when workflows fail, integrations stall or exceptions accumulate in ways that threaten revenue or customer outcomes.
Compliance requirements vary by industry and geography, but the operating principle is consistent: every automated action that affects scope, billing, staffing or customer communication should be traceable. This is especially important in cloud-native environments where services may be distributed across containers, Kubernetes-managed workloads, PostgreSQL-backed transactional systems and Redis-supported performance layers. The technical stack matters only insofar as it supports resilience, auditability and enterprise scalability. Managed Cloud Services can add value when internal teams need stronger operational discipline around uptime, patching, backup, security posture and environment governance.
Common implementation mistakes that weaken ROI
- Automating broken processes before clarifying ownership, approval logic and exception handling.
- Treating timesheet, billing and staffing workflows as separate initiatives instead of one engagement operating model.
- Over-customizing ERP behavior when configuration, process redesign or integration discipline would solve the problem more sustainably.
- Ignoring master data quality for skills, roles, rates, project templates and customer terms.
- Deploying AI features without governance, auditability or clear business thresholds for human review.
- Measuring success by task automation counts rather than utilization, margin, billing cycle time, forecast accuracy and customer delivery outcomes.
How to build the business case for Professional Services ERP Process Automation for Engagement Operations
The strongest business case is framed around operational economics, not software features. Executives should quantify where engagement friction creates financial drag: delayed project starts, underutilized consultants, unbilled work, approval bottlenecks, write-offs, inconsistent change control and weak forecast confidence. Automation creates ROI when it compresses cycle times, improves resource deployment, protects billable revenue and reduces management overhead. It also improves decision quality by making operational intelligence available earlier, when corrective action is still possible.
A phased roadmap usually outperforms a large transformation program. Start with one or two high-friction workflows that cross commercial, delivery and finance boundaries. Establish baseline metrics, automate the handoffs, instrument the process and review exception patterns. Then expand into adjacent workflows such as renewals, support-to-project transitions or multi-entity billing governance.
